European Comment: Berlin's Houdini in knots

Published: November 4 2004 22:08 | Last updated: November 4 2004 22:08

For Hans Eichel read Harry Houdini. The German finance minister is twisting himself into ridiculous contortions to get Germany's budget deficit within European Union limits next year for the first time since 2001.

Political and economic constraints prevent him from doing the obvious: cutting Germany's €157bn of state subsidies and tax breaks coupled with comprehensive tax reform to address the budget's structural weakness.
